redis 使用记录

2017/01/17 15:20
阅读数 0

一、 redis 安装参考:http://www.jb51.net/article/79096.htm  或

http://www.redis.cn/download.html

 

下载,解压,编译:

$ wget http://download.redis.io/releases/redis-3.2.8.tar.gz
$ tar xzf redis-3.2.8.tar.gz
$ cd redis-3.2.8
$ make

 

redis-server /usr..../redis.conf 启动redis服务,并指定配置文件
redis-cli 启动redis 客户端
pkill redis-server 关闭redis服务
redis-cli shutdown 关闭redis客户端
netstat -tunpl|grep 6379 查看redis 默认端口号6379占用情况

http://blog.csdn.net/jiongyi1/article/details/53406223

6.外网怎么测试连接redis服务器呢,首先需要防火墙允许redis端口6379开放出来。

a) iptables -I INPUT 4 -p tcp -m state --state NEW -m tcp --dport 6379 -j ACCEPT
#允许6379端口
b) service iptables save  #保存iptables规则

Redis 安装之后不能通过外网访问:

redis.conf 配置修改

1、修改conf 配置 注释绑定id 127.0.0.1  

2、设置redis 访问密码  找到 #requirepass foobared   放开注释设置密码

3、后台启动redis服务

a)首先编辑redis  目录/redis.conf 文件,将daemonize属性改为yes(表明需要在后台运行)

b)再次启动redis服务,并指定启动服务配置文件

redis-server /usr/local/redis/etc/redis.conf

==============================================

二、spring boot data redis 三种配置方式

参考:http://blog.csdn.net/jiongyi1/article/details/53406223

# redis 单机版
#spring.redis.host: 10.100.112.139
#spring.redis.password: 123456
#spring.redis.port: 6379
#spring.redis.database: 3

# redis sentine 主从复制:master:哨兵名称,nodes:主节点列表
#spring.redis.sentinel.master=: tokenmaster
#spring.redis.sentinel.nodes: 192.168.204.129:26379

# redis cluster 3.0集群: nodes:集群中的节点(配一个即可,因为节点中间没有代理层,互相感知),
#max-redirects:最大重定向,由于集群失败机制是多数失败则失败,那么集群的最低标准是3个分片,1主1从,总共六个节点,
#所以如果当前节点失败,最大的重定向为6-1=5,spring默认的也为5
# 源码中 int redirects = clusterConfig.getMaxRedirects() != null ? clusterConfig.getMaxRedirects().intValue() : 5;
#spring.redis.cluster.nodes: 192.168.204.129:7001,192.168.204.129:7002,192.168.204.129:7003,192.168.204.129:7004,192.168.204.129:7005,192.168.204.129:7006
#spring.redis.cluster.max-redirects: 5

 

三、主从复制

参考:http://www.cnblogs.com/think-in-java/p/5123884.html

展开阅读全文
打赏
0
0 收藏
分享
打赏
0 评论
0 收藏
0
分享
返回顶部
顶部